HBM demand is set to explode by 2027.
Nvidia still leads HBM consumption at 36%, but Google is right behind at 35%. AMD takes 16%, AWS 5%, with Microsoft, Meta, and others making up the rest.

Total HBM demand is projected to surge past 6 million kGB. The growth from 2023 through 2027 shows Nvidia remaining the largest single consumer, yet Google’s share is rising fast with massive TPU deployments.

Memory makers with advanced HBM capacity, such as SK Hynix, Samsung, and Micron, sit in a powerful position as supply stays extremely tight.
The AI race is increasingly a memory race.
